Output 30e769553795334b49a8fecdeb09256f24787d702ebfd48d52dcf303c24eadc3:3

value
830691426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6832c6552b8b39cc92ac94d48f8bf24959b80e9 OP_EQUAL
address
3MFFfgf3exvEPvsMq2tUcF3J7a4jhCLLSh
transaction
30e769553795334b49a8fecdeb09256f24787d702ebfd48d52dcf303c24eadc3
spent
true